Now I have to hope that Stutzle somehow drops to fourth. I mean I highly doubt it will happen but I guess it depends on how LA and Ottawa views some of the other players.

Yzerman should negotiate some deal with Ottawa to arrange this.

Who knows if Sens are interested of the Swedish-duo (Raymond & Holtz). Or maybe a defenceman? Sens have great centers already (Josh Norris, Shane Pinto, Colin White, Logan Brown). Mostly they are lacking right-handed wingers and right-handed skill defencemen, and elite goalie prospect. This draft offers them all on their pick range.
